Collection of Data by BlueBible

BlueBible does not collect any personal or analytic information from you or about you from your use of the application.

User Generated Data

Any data you generate within the BlueBible application is stored locally on your device and is not transmitted to BlueBible's back-end server, with the exception of posts, comments, and avatars in the 'BlueList' social feature, and your day off group if you choose to make use of the 'Calendar Sharing' feature.

User accounts and passwords

An email address and password are required to create an account. User authentication is handled by Firebase, which securely protects your password by converting it with a hashing algorithm, meaning that neither BlueBible nor Firebase have access to your original plain-text password.

Collection of Data by Other Entities

The operating system on your device and its associated application platform and/or application store (Entities) may collect personal and/or analytic information relating to your use of this application, including (but not limited to) crash data, operating system version, country/regional information, and other usage, analytic, and technical information. These Entities may share this information with BlueBible for purposes related to application development, testing, and troubleshooting, pursuant to their own privacy policies.

Third-Party Links and Websites

BlueBible links to some third-party websites. BlueBible does not track your browsing history or any other information about your usage of third-party websites. BlueBible does not assume any responsibility for your use of third-party websites or any data collected by third-party websites.
